Open circuit voltage voc the open circuit voltage is the maximum voltage that the solar panel can produce with no load on it i e.
The open circuit voltage v oc is the maximum voltage available from a solar cell and this occurs at zero current.

If you just measure with a voltmeter across the plus and minus leads you will read voc.
If two or more panels are wired in series it will be voc of panel 1 voc of panel 2 etc.
